While teachers recognize the need for differentiated instruction, growing workloads create substantial barriers, making differentiated instruction an ideal that is often unrealized in practice. Current AI educational tools, which promise differentiated materials, are predominantly student-facing and performance-centric, ignoring other aspects that shape learning outcomes. We introduce FACET, a teacher-facing multi-agent framework designed to address these gaps by supporting differentiation that accounts for motivation, performance, and learning differences. Developed with educational stakeholders from the outset, the framework coordinates four specialized agents, including learner simulation, diagnostic assessment, material generation, and evaluation within a teacher-in-the-loop design. School principals (N = 30) shaped system requirements through participatory workshops, while in-service K-12 teachers (N = 70) evaluated material quality. Mixed-methods evaluation demonstrates strong perceived value for inclusive differentiation. Practitioners emphasized both the urgent need arising from classroom heterogeneity and the importance of maintaining pedagogical autonomy as a prerequisite for adoption. OR 2024}, pages = {348 -- 354}, year = {2025}, abstract = {It is well-known that optimal solutions are notoriously hard to find for the Periodic Event Scheduling Problem (PESP), which is the standard mathematical formulation to optimize periodic timetables in public transport. We consider a class of incremental heuristics that have been demonstrated to be effective by Lindner and Liebchen (2023), however, for only one fixed sorting strategy of lines along which a solution is constructed. Thus, in this paper, we examine a variety of sortings based on the number, weight, weighted span, and lower bound of arcs, and test for each setting various combinations of the driving, dwelling, and transfer arcs of lines. Additionally, we assess the impact on the incremental extension of the event-activity network by minimizing resp. maximizing a connectivity measure between subsets of lines. We compare our 27 sortings on the railway instances of the benchmarking library PESPlib within the ConcurrentPESP solver framework. We are able to find five new incumbent solutions, resulting in improvements of up to 2\%.}, language = {en} } @article{HalbigHoenGleixneretal.2025, author = {Halbig, Katrin and Hoen, Alexander and Gleixner, Ambros and Witzig, Jakob and Weninger, Dieter}, title = {A diving heuristic for mixed-integer problems with unbounded semi-continuous variables}, volume = {13}, journal = {EURO Journal on Computational Optimization}, doi = {10.1016/j.ejco.2025.100107}, year = {2025}, language = {en} } @article{BestuzhevaGleixnerAchterberg2025, author = {Bestuzheva, Ksenia and Gleixner, Ambros and Achterberg, Tobias}, title = {Efficient separation of RLT cuts for implicit and explicit bilinear terms}, volume = {210}, journal = {Mathematical Programming}, doi = {10.1007/s10107-024-02104-0}, pages = {47 -- 74}, year = {2025}, language = {en} }
